Elusive foundation Synonyms

Definitions for Elusive


  • (adjective) hard to find, capture, or isolate
  • (adjective) skillful at eluding capture
  • (adjective) difficult to detect or grasp by the mind or analyze

Definitions for Foundation


  • (noun) a public organization with a particular purpose or function
  • (noun) an immaterial thing upon which something else rests
  • (noun) the basis on which something is grounded